Output e25dddc21b2d64405c8aeb50ca70d46450c0e35a4c7984d4b30ff387f367e533:5

value
1012575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a85cfa86ae81e4248e6f490d96b0201d9883abc OP_EQUAL
address
3HEf6WyLwHBjjQPt4Cu3XW3J2Jg8JEQSaK
transaction
e25dddc21b2d64405c8aeb50ca70d46450c0e35a4c7984d4b30ff387f367e533
spent
true